Anyone here a member of National Forensics League? By that I mean do you participate in Speech and Debate in your school or did you in the past? If so, what event do you participate in, about how many NFL points do you have, and what kind of accolades have you received?

I participate in Dramatic Interpretation this year after two years of Humorous Interpretation. I've placed a few times now in tournaments, and I've been told I'm quite good. I have around 300+ points and rising. This year I plan on qualifying for our state tournament and hope that all works out. My speech this year is The Strange Case of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de if anyone cares.

And yes, this totally belongs in the Sport Forum because to me speech is a sport and anyone who participates will more than likely agree with that.
